Traser S3101

This is a sturdy quartz watch with tritium illumination. I bought the one with a nylon strap.

Description and what I think about it

This model has a steel case and screw in crown. Those features makes me think it's better value than the model which lacks those features.

Features

The main feature is of course the tritium gas illuminated dial and hands. They really work very well, but when coming in from bright daylight they're not as bright as good Superluminova is for up to 30 minutes.

Dial, hands and crystal

The chrystal has a very good anti-reflective coating, the dial is a good flat brown and the contrast with the hands is good, so legibility is good. It also looks good.

I had my chrystal upgraded to sapphire.

Wearing comfort and usability

It is a pretty large watch, so I've had some problems finding a strap I really like. The supplied velcro strap works well and is comfortable enough, but I don't prefer velcro in the long run. I've also used it with a Rhino strap but the one I prefer at present is a Super Sport Aquacalf strap which is quite soft but seems durable. Fit is perhaps not the best, I'd need larger wrists for that, but it's comfortable and looks good.

Accuracy

I can use it as a reference for all my other watches.

Design, fit and finish

I think the design is rather well thought out and I've got only good things to say about how well it's made.

What it comes delivered with

Not very much, but exactly the instructions you might need. It's shipped in a cylindrical box.

Basic data

Diameter:    43-46 mm
Thickness:   11.1 mm
Weight:      56 g
Strap width: 22 mm
